.top{width: 100%;height: 270px;background: url(../img/banner.jpg) no-repeat;background-size: cover;}
.top .timeAndReg{height: 50px;line-height: 50px;width: 1200px;margin:0 auto;}
.top .time span{color: #656565;}
.top .time span:nth-child(1){margin: 0 30px;}
.top .timeAndReg > .time.fl{    overflow: hidden;width: 250px;}
.top .reg a{width: 150px;}
.top .reg a{display: inline-block;width: 155px;height: 35px;line-height: 35px;color: #656565;text-indent: 15px;}
.top .reg a:hover{background: url(../img/denlu_hover.png) no-repeat;color: #fff;}
.top .reg a img{vertical-align: middle;margin-right: 10px;}
.top .logo{margin: 0 auto;margin-top: 10px;text-align: center;}
.menu{width: 100%;height: 50px;line-height: 50px;background-color: #8D322C;margin-bottom: 50px;}
.menu ul{width: 1200px;margin:0 auto;}
.menu ul li{width: 192px;height: 50px;text-indent: 30px;}
.menu ul .li_active{background: url(../img/menu_hover.png) no-repeat;}
.menu ul li a{color: rgba(255,255,255,0.7);font-size: 20px;}
.menu ul li:nth-child(6) div{position: relative;}
.menu ul li:nth-child(6) div img{position: absolute;top: 16px;right: -8px;}
.menu ul li:nth-child(6) div input{width: 176px;height: 30px;border: 1px solid #DB8A86;background-color: #8D322C;text-indent: 10px;color: #fff;}
.bottom{width: 100%;height: 110px;position: relative;border-top: 1px solid #A05550;margin-top: 50px;background-color: rgba(148,148,148,0.2);}
.bottom .leftBg{bottom: 0;left: 0;position: absolute;z-index: -1;}
.bottom .rightBg{bottom: 0;right: 0;position: absolute;z-index: -1;}
.bottom .bottomCont{width: 1200px;margin: 0 auto;margin-top: 30px;}
.bottom .bottomCont select{border: none;height: 37px;background-color: #D9D9D9;width: 248px;text-indent: 30px;}
.bottom .bottomCont span{margin-right: 30px;}

.content{width: 1200px;margin: 0 auto;}
.content .enter{width: 240px;padding: 0 25px;}
.content .enter ul li{text-align: center;width: 120px;margin-top: 66px;}
.content .enter ul li:nth-child(1){margin-top: 10px;}
.content .enter ul li:nth-child(2){margin-top: 13px;}
.content .enter ul li a{display: inline-block;width: 100%;height: 100%;}

.position{width: 100%;height: 54px;background-color: #F0F0F0;line-height: 54px;margin-top: -50px;text-indent: 25px;}
.contSearch{margin-top: 40px;}
.contSearch div a{display: inline-block;width: 93px;height: 40px;line-height: 40px;text-align: center;background-color: #8D322C;}
.contSearch div a img{vertical-align: middle;}
.contSearch div input{width: 587px;height: 38px;border: 1px solid #F4C9CD;margin-left: 240px;}
.contSearch div p{width: 100px;height: 40px;line-height: 40px;text-align: center;font-size: 18px;color:#8D312C;background: url(../img/xiangshang.png) right center no-repeat;cursor: pointer;}
.contSearch div .pActive{background: url(../img/xiangxia.png) right center no-repeat;}
.contSearchCon{margin-top: 35px;}
.contSearchCon .seaechFirst{border-bottom: 1px solid #E2E2E2;line-height: 50px;}
.contSearchCon .seaechFirst p:nth-child(1){width: 100px;text-align: right;font-weight: 700;margin: 0 30px;font-size: 16px;}
.contSearchCon .seaechFirst p select{width: 248px;height: 29px;border: 1px solid #F4C9CD;}
.contSearchCon .seaechFirst p a{color: #656565;padding: 5px 10px;margin-right: 20px;}
.searchAActive{color: #fff!important;background-color: #E28E15;}

